In a 1-quart mason jar, layer the ingredients as evenly as possible. Place macaroni in a plastic sandwich bag and place on the top.
2
Place the lid and ring on the jar and attach the instructions below.
3
Beefy Bean Soup Mix
4
Additional ingredients needed:
5
1 lb. ground beef
6
3 quarts beef broth
7
To make soup:
8
Coat a large pot or Dutch oven with cooking spray and warm over medium-high heat. Add beef and cook, stirring constantly, about 4 minutes, or until no pink remains. Drain off excess fat. Add broth and all of the jar ingredients (except the bag of macaroni) to the pot.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to low, cover and simmer for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ally.
9
Add macaroni and continue to simmer another 10 minutes, or until peas are tender and macaroni is cooked. Serve hot. Refrigerate any leftover soup in an airtight container for up to a week.
